Output 85b85d9417c1e9caafa84f42084ba63e606f0be08c68e9bcc69b36a8cf3f5d20:24

value
99596
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8476774157c3ea77af1c2387d5a0779c8891b8d2 OP_EQUAL
address
3DmR31u421Ex4zaMehsc447kHpbb6EWxft
transaction
85b85d9417c1e9caafa84f42084ba63e606f0be08c68e9bcc69b36a8cf3f5d20